tp官方下载安卓最新版本2024-tpwallet下载/最新版本/安卓版安装-tp官网入口
导言:
本指南面向开发者、产品经理与安全工程师,系统说明在 TPWallet 中测试代币的实操步骤,并围绕全球部署策略、高效数据处理、私密支付保护、安全支付认证、私密交易模式、技术解读与数字支付创新给出具体建议与测试方法。文后附多条基于文章内容生成的相关标题,便于内容传播与分支撰写。
相关标题:
1) 在 TPWallet 上从零开始测试代币与私密支付实战
2) TPWallet 代币测试、隐私保护与全球化部署策略
3) 高效数据驱动下的 TPWallet 支付与认证设计
4) 私密交易模式在移动钱包中的实现与测试方案
5) 从智能合约到 UX:TPWallet 支付安全全链路测试
一、测试代币的基础流程(实操步骤)
1. 环境准备:安装 TPWallet 最新版本,备份助记词/私钥,启用开发者模式或连接到钱包 SDK 的本地调试环境。建议在模拟器与真机都测试。
2. 选择网络:优先使用对应链的 Testnet(如以太坊 Goerli、BSC 测试网、Polygon Mumbai)进行所有代币交互测试,避免主网费用与风险。
3. 导入/添加代币:在钱包里添加“自定义代币”时使用测试网代币合约地址,验证 decimals、symbol、合约代码与 ABI。
4. 获取测试币:使用水龙头或私有测试链配置的发币脚本获取足够的测试金额进行多场景尝试。
5. 交易流程测试:发起转账、approve/transferFrom、使用 permit(ERC-2612)和 meta-transactions,检查签名内容、gas 消耗、nonce 管理与失败回滚。
6. 事件与链上验证:在区块浏览器或自建 indexer 上确认 Transfer/Approval 等事件,确保钱包 UI 与链上状态一致。
7. 异常场景:测试网络延迟、nonce 冲突、gas 不足、合约重入攻击模拟、拒绝服务与合约异常 revert 情况下的 UX 与提示。
8. 权限管理:测试撤销 approve、批量 revoke、时间锁与限额策略,验证安全提示是否充分。
二、高效数据处理与监控策略
- 实时性:采用区块链节点的 websocket 或第三方 indexer(如 The Graph、自建 PostgreSQL+重放器)保证实时事件流,减少轮询成本。
- 批处理与分片:对大量地址/交易做批量查询(batch RPC、 multicallhttps://www.xyedusx.com ,)以提高效率;对日志按链/合约分片处理。
- 缓存与一致性:本地缓存 token metadata 与价格信息,使用短 TTL 并结合链上校验避免展示错误数据。
- 可观测性:埋点交易生命周期(创建、签名、广播、确认、失败),配合 Prometheus/Grafana 与告警策略进行 SLA 管控。
三、私密支付保护与隐私设计原则
- 最小化链上可识别信息:在 UI 与链上交互间避免泄露过多交易标签或关联元数据。
- 选择适当技术:根据合规与 UX 需求,可以使用零知识证明(zk-SNARK/zk-STARK)实现隐私汇总证明、使用隐匿地址(stealth addresses)、或借助 CoinJoin/混币服务(需注意合规风险)。
- 链外隐私:敏感 KYC 与用户标识尽量链下存储,采用分片存储与加密存储;考虑 ZK-KYC 实现合规同时不泄露用户资料。
四、安全支付认证与签名策略
- 私钥与签名:推荐对接硬件钱包(Ledger、Trezor)或TEE保护的密钥库;支持 EIP-712 人类可读签名请求以防钓鱼。
- 交易认证增强:多重签名(multisig)、阈值签名、支付限额、二次确认策略(敏感操作)与设备绑定策略结合生物识别/OTP 做强认证。
- 防重放与防篡改:严格维护 nonce 管理、时间戳校验与链 ID 检查;对离线签名场景做详尽测试。
五、私密交易模式实战比较
- CoinJoin:对等混合,适用于提高匿名性但对 UX 与手续费敏感;测试关注交易配对、延迟与链上可归因性。
- Ring Signatures(如 Monero):提供强隐私但需特殊链支持,钱包需支持完整节点或轻节点实现。
- zk 技术:在账户抽象与批量结算场景下非常适用,测试应覆盖证明生成时间、验证成本与失败回滚。
- 离线/通道支付:闪电网络或类似通道可实现私密、低费支付,需测试通道生命周期与资金安全。
六、技术解读与智能合约测试方法
- 单元测试:在 Hardhat/Foundry/Truffle 中对 ERC20/ERC-777/自定义合约做充分单元测试,覆盖边界值、权限、重入与断言。
- 集成与端到端:在模拟器或测试网运行 UI->SDK->RPC->合约的完整流程,使用自动化脚本(Playwright/Appium)验证 UX。
- Fuzz 与模糊测试:用 Echidna、LLVM-fuzz 等工具发现未预见的输入导致的异常。
- 性能与压力:做并发交易压测,验证 nonce 排队、内存占用与后端索引器的扩展性。
- 合规性测试:对接制裁名单、AML 风险标识逻辑与隐私选项的开关测试。
七、全球策略与数字支付创新建议
- 本地化与合规:不同司法辖区对隐私与加密资产有差异,设计可配置的隐私等级与合规开关。
- 多资产与法币桥:支持多链与多法币通道,集成多家支付网关与本地水龙头以适应市场。

- 创新产品:可探索基于 token 的订阅支付、可组合支付(分期+担保)、可验证隐私(ZK-based receipts)与离线可恢复支付方案。

- 合作生态:与监管友好型托管、KYC 提供方与流动性方合作,形成安全、易用且合规的服务链。
八、示例测试流程(快速清单)
1) 创建/导入钱包并备份密钥;2) 切换到测试网并取水龙头币;3) 添加自定义代币地址并验证余额;4) 发起转账与 approve 场景,观察链上事件;5) 测试失败场景与弹性重试;6) 验证硬件钱包签名与 EIP-712 展示;7) 运行模糊测试与负载测试;8) 检查数据指标与告警是否触发。
九、风险与合规提醒
在实现私密功能时,要评估法律风险(反洗钱、制裁与税务披露),对用户进行清晰说明并提供可选的隐私级别。任何混币或匿名服务均需谨慎纳入产品路线。
结语:
TPWallet 的代币测试不仅是验证转账能否成功,更是对用户隐私保护、支付认证与全球部署能力的全面考察。通过严格的链上/链下测试流程、高效的数据处理架构与可配置的隐私策略,能在保证合规与安全的前提下,构建更具创新性的数字支付方案。